Footymad preview History of the Notts. County v Leyton Orient fixture

Leyton Orient face a trip to Notts. County at Meadow Lane on Saturday afternoon, needing to turn around their fortunes at the ground. The O's will be hoping to improve upon a record which has seen them lose 19 and win only 8 of the 33 games.

The most recent encounter between these two sides was just last season, in September 2010, as the Magpies edged out their past their rivals by a score of 3-2 in a League One match.

Recent respective form guides

Notts. County have been playing quite well at home, winning 3, drawing 2, and losing just 1. A total of 13 goals have been scored by the Magpies in those games, with 8 conceded.

Leyton Orient have an average recent record on the road, with two wins, two draws, and two defeats. The O's's have a narrow positive goal difference over these games, with 11 goals for and 10 against.

Notts. County lie just outside the playoff positions in the npower League One, picking up 31 points from their 20 games so far.

Leyton Orient find themselves struggling down in 17th position in the league having picked up 22 points from their 20 matches.
